Drunk Dial

Drunk Dial is a book written by Penelope Ward as a contemporary romance. Rana is a broken and damaged person who doesn’t trust easily. She has not been able to forget about Landon Roderick, the boy from her childhood. He forgot about her so easily. One day, she decides to call him. It didn’t seem like a bad idea at the time.

Then again, any idea can sound good when you’re drunk before nighttime. It was just supposed to be a harmless prank. But when he picks the call, she unloads the resentment of 13 years on him. She didn’t think he would call her back, but she was wrong.

Landon also hadn’t forgotten about her. The next thing she knows, she’s going to California. She is about to find out whether one phone call can bring two people together or it was just a big mistake on her part.
